KATHMANDU, Oct 12: An aftershock measuring 4.1 on the Richter scale rocked central Nepal on Wednesday afternoon.
According to the National Seismological Center (NSC), Lainchaur, the tremor was recorded at 2:14 pm today with its epicenter in Dolakha. The tremor was felt in Dolakha, Ramechhap, Kathmandu and Kavrepalanchowk.
Earlier, an aftershock measuring 4.6 on Richter scale rocked the Kathmandu Valley at 12:53 pm yesterday with its epicenter in Dolakha.
As many as 472 aftershocks have occurred so far following the Gorkha earthquake that devastated Nepal on April 25 in 2015.
